The Importance of Mitochondrial Health
Mitochondrial function decreases with age, causing reduced energy levels and a range of health issues such as fatigue, muscle weak point, and even cognitive decrease. Research has shown that preserving mitochondrial health can not only improve energy production however likewise may improve physical performance, boost psychological clarity, and support durability.

There are several kinds of supplements created to support mitochondrial health, each with its own distinct advantages. Here's a list of a few of the most popular options:
1. Coenzyme Q10 (CoQ10)
CoQ10 is a naturally occurring antioxidant discovered in the body, primarily in the mitochondria, where it plays an important role in energy production.
Advantages:

ALA is another powerful anti-oxidant that helps secure mitochondria from complimentary radical damage. It is special in that it is both water and fat-soluble, permitting it to work throughout the body.
Advantages:

ALCAR plays an essential role in carrying fatty acids into the mitochondria, where they can be converted into energy.
Benefits:

NAD+ is a coenzyme involved in numerous cellular procedures, consisting of energy metabolism and DNA repair.
Advantages:

While mitochondrial health supplements can be advantageous, they might not be appropriate for everyone. Possible negative effects can vary by individual and supplement type.
SupplementPossible Side EffectsCoenzyme Q10Gastrointestinal upset, allergiesAlpha-Lipoic AcidNausea, lightheadednessAcetyl-L-CarnitineSleeping disorders, intestinal concernsNAD+ PrecursorsMild gastrointestinal pain, might improve energy excessiveResveratrolRisk of bleeding, gastrointestinal upsetPterostilbeneHeadaches, gastrointestinal issuesCurcuminStomach upset, danger of bleedingThings to Consider:
Consult a Healthcare Provider: Always talk with a healthcare expert before starting any new supplement, particularly if you are pregnant, nursing, or have underlying health conditions.
Quality Matters: Look for high-quality supplements from respectable brands that go through third-party screening for safety and effectiveness.
Diet and Lifestyle: Supplements ought to complement a well balanced diet and healthy lifestyle instead of replace them.
Individual Variation: Everyone's body responds differently to supplements, so it may take some time to discover what works for you.

2. Exist dietary sources of these supplements?
Some foods abundant in antioxidants and other nutrients can support mitochondrial health. For example, fatty fish are good sources of CoQ10, while red wine consists of resveratrol. Foods high in healthy fats (like avocados and nuts) can likewise provide support.
3. For how long does it take to see outcomes from mitochondrial supplements?
Effects can differ substantially based upon the supplement type, specific metabolism, and way of life elements. Some may see enhancements within weeks, while others might take longer.
4. Are mitochondrial health supplements safe?
Usually, mitochondrial health supplements are safe for many people when taken as directed. However, prospective negative effects and interactions with other medications must be considered.
